#2763: Undo/Redo system porting from v2
-------------------------------+--------------------------------------------
Reporter: garry.yao | Owner: garry.yao
Type: New Feature | Status: assigned
Priority: Normal | Milestone: CKEditor 3.0
Component: General | Version:
Keywords: Confirmed Review- |
-------------------------------+--------------------------------------------
Comment(by garry.yao):
Replying to [comment:4 fredck]:
> Also, I've noted the new "serializable" feature for the bookmarks. While
the intention is good, it's not a good thing for us in this case. The undo
system executes several times during the document lifetime. Using the
current bookmarks, you are constantly adding nodes to the DOM.
>
I don't quite understand the last point since the bookmark nodes will also
be removed just like ordinary bookmark in
''CKEDITOR.dom.range::moveToBookmark''.[[BR]]
> The above is not necessary as a undo snapshot is "stable". It contains a
DOM tree and the selection position can safely be reconstructed by using
the node counting system used in V2 (CreateBookmark2). So, I would do a
step back an use that non intrusive bookmark system again.
>
My original consideration on the unobtrusive bookmark (CreateBookmark2) is
that it might be weaker than current one from PF.
--
Ticket URL: <http://dev.fckeditor.net/ticket/2763#comment:5>
FCKeditor <http://www.fckeditor.net/>
The text editor for Internet
------------------------------------------------------------------------------
Create and Deploy Rich Internet Apps outside the browser with Adobe(R)AIR(TM)
software. With Adobe AIR, Ajax developers can use existing skills and code to
build responsive, highly engaging applications that combine the power of local
resources and data with the reach of the web. Download the Adobe AIR SDK and
Ajax docs to start building applications today-http://p.sf.net/sfu/adobe-com
_______________________________________________
FCKeditor-Trac m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/fckeditor-trac